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44114248 57905322227 53
496 52109394228
496 52109394228
05237391 80 05281 9835133063
All about undefined
Interested in learning more?
496 52109394228
05237391 80 05281 9835133063
See more
5464 69935816525 6481669997
79 1835 42841 6422 26197935
See more
18886050476 9666259
29717669 1308256 2998059
See more